MyTradeGrid
Atom
11/8/2013
Rebelion


День добрый!

Параллельно разбираясь со свечками Ренко (оффтоп), у меня возникла проблема - хочу, чтобы по стратегиям, кои шлют у меня сообщения о сделках в одно окно MyTradeGrid (в качестве каркаса для робота брал Sample SMA), у меня отображались такие поля, как PnL и Position. Но не могу добавить эти поля через конструктор. Подскажите, как сделать соответствующую привязку? В мануале есть код

Code

<Label Grid.Column="0" Grid.Row="5" Content="Поза:" />
<Label x:Name="Position" Grid.Column="1" Grid.Row="5" />


Но он не подвязывается к MyTradeGrid никак. Подскажите, что сделать-то нужно в итоге?

В отношении кода:

Code

this.Sync(() =>
{
    Status.Content = _strategy.ProcessState;
    PnL.Content = _strategy.PnLManager.PnL;
    Slippage.Content = _strategy.SlippageManager.Slippage;
    Position.Content = _strategy.PositionManager.Position;
});


Подскажите, эта строчка нужна только для того, чтобы отображать текущее состояние портфеля?
Code

Position.Content = _strategy.PositionManager.Position;


Заранее спасибо.



Thanks:


Rebelion

Avatar
Date: 11/13/2013
Reply


Ап-ап-ап-ап-ап-ап-ап-ап! Актуально весьма, товарищи!!
Thanks:


Attach files by dragging & dropping, , or pasting from the clipboard.

loading
clippy